New York’s receiving corps continues to take hits

Who will be available to catch passes from New York Giants quarterback Daniel Jones on Sunday against the Carolina Panthers is anyone’s guess. Wide receivers Kenny Golladay (knee) and Kadarius Toney (ankle) are out. So, too, is running back Saquon Barkley (ankle).

Several other Giants pass catchers are questionable.

Tight end Evan Engram is questionable with a calf injury. He missed two games earlier this season with a calf issue, and was a limited participant Friday after missing Thursday’s practice.

Wide receivers John Ross, Sterling Shepard and Darius Slayton are all questionable with hamstring injuries. Ross was on IR earlier this year with a hamstring issue. Slayton has missed three games with a hamstring. Shepard missed two games with a hamstring injury of his own, but returned Sunday and had 10 catches vs. the Los Angeles Rams.

Defensive tackle Danny Shelton (pectoral) is listed as doubtful.

In an alarming development for the already injury-ravaged New York Giants, two more of their key play makers showed up on the team’s injury report on Thursday afternoon. Tight end Evan Engram, who missed two games this season with a calf injury, was listed as ‘did not practice’ with a calf injury. Wide receiver Sterling Shepard, who missed two games with a hamstring injury, was listed as ‘limited’ due to a hamstring issue.

No word from the Giants as to whether these might have been rest days for Engram and Shepard due to their previous injuries.

The Giants will already be without Saquon Barkley (ankle), wide receiver Kenny Golladay (knee) and wide receiver Kadarius Toney (ankle).

WEDNESDAY

Kadarius Toney is not expected to be placed on injured reserve due to his ankle injury, New York Giants coach Joe Judge told assembled media on Wednesday.

“We haven’t had any conversations that would lead to anything with IR,” Judge said.

Toney, the electrifying rookie wide receiver, injured his ankle during his breakout 10-catch, 189-yard performance against the Dallas Cowboys in Week 5. He left Sunday’s game against the Los Angeles Rams after playing only six snaps, having aggravated the same injury.

A report earlier this week indicated that Toney would not play against Carolina. Judge was not willing to make that proclamation on Wednesday, saying only that Toney would work with trainers today.

Judge also said the same thing about running back Saquon Barkley (ankle) and wide receiver Kenny Golladay (knee). Both players missed the game against the Cowboys and are expected to miss Sunday’s game against Carolina, as well.

The Giants already placed starting left tackle Andrew Thomas (foot/ankle) on IR this week.

The good news on Wednesday was that, as expected, the Giants designated rookies Aaron Robinson and Elerson Smith to return. Both were to practice for the first time. Robinson, a cornerback, has been on PUP with a core muscle injury. Smith, an edge defender, has been on IR with a hamstring injury.

The Giants have 21 days to add them to the 53-man roster.
